Meaning of Assurance
a statement that something will certainly be true or will certainly happen, particularly when there has been doubt about it
In simple words: A promise that something will happen or be true.
Assurance in a sentence
- The company offered an assurance that their products were of the highest quality.
- She spoke with such assurance that everyone believed her.
- His assurance made the team feel more confident about the project's success.
- The contract includes an assurance of timely delivery.
- They needed the assurance of safety before proceeding with the adventure.
How to use Assurance
Often used in business or legal contexts when making promises or guarantees. Not commonly used in casual conversations.

Opposites of Assurance
- doubt
- uncertainty
- insecurity
Common mistakes with Assurance
- Confused with 'insure' or 'ensure'
- Used in informal situations where simpler words would be better
- Mispronunciation, especially stressing the wrong syllable
